MORRINSVILLE ANGLICANS.

ANNUAL MEETING,

FINANCIAL POSITION DISCUSSED

(From Our Own Correspondent.)

MORRINSVILLE, Friday.

There was a good attendance at the annual meeting of parishioners of -St. Matthew's (Anglican) Church, the vicar, Rev. F. W. Wilkes, presiding.

In the annual report it was stated that the general financial support had been ' poor. Expenditure for the year hid been some £115 in excess of the receipts,. and the accumulated deficiency of, the general fund was now approximately £300. For the year the ordinary offertories increased by £35, but subscriptions fell by £15. ' The election of officers • resulted: —- Vicar a warden, Mr. C. M. Gummer; people's warden, Mr. A. H. J.
